F Prof. Susanta Lahiri, professor at Homi Bhabha National Institute, Mumbai was awarded Hevesy Medal Award for his contributions to heavy ion induced radioisotope production, tracer packet technique, converter targets, and green chemistry. He is a co-creator of super heavy element 117. Hevesy Medal is an international award named after George de Hevesy, the 1943- Chemistry Nobel Laureate.

F Dr. Pramod Patil and Dr. Ananda Kumar have been awarded Whitley Awards, instituted by Whitley Fund for Nature, United Kingdom. The awards are also called 'Green Oscars'. Dr Ananda Kumar was awarded the prize, for an elephant warning system that has saved human lives and reduced damage to property in the Valparai area. Dr. Pramod Patil has been awarded for his work to protect the great Indian bustard in the Thar Desert 

F Akash is India's first indigenously designed, developed and produced air defence surface-to-air missile system has recently been inducted into the Indian Army. The missile, having a maximum range of 25 kilometers, can neutralise targets at a maximum altitude of 20 kilometers. An Air Force variant of Akash has already been inducted.

F Two Indians, Naik Nand Ram and Raju Joseph are among those who were posthumously chosen for the United Nations Dag Hammarskjold Medal. It is a posthumous award given by the United Nations to military personnel, police, or civilians who lose their lives while serving in a United Nations peace keeping operation.

F The Hungarian writer, Laszlo Krasznahorkai has won the 2015 edition of the biennial award, Man Booker, International Prize. The prize is intended to honour a living author for their body of work, either written in English or available in English translation.

F The American mathematician, John Forbes Nash, Jr, known for the contributions made to game theory, differential geometry, and differential equations, passed away on May 23. He was awarded Nobel Prize in Economics in 1994 for 'the pioneering analysis of equilibrium in the theory of non-cooperative games'. The biography of Nash, A Beautiful Mind was released as a movie in 2001.

F Gunter Grass, German poet, novelist, playwright, sculptor and graphic artist who was awarded the 1999 Nobel Prize in literature, passed away recently. His popular novels are The Tin Drum, Cat and Mouse, Dog Years, Crabwalk and What must be Said.

F The solar powered single-seater aircraft, Solar Impulse-2 is presently on a journey around the earth. The aircraft is made of carbon fiber. It took off from Abu Dhabi on March 9th marking the start of the first attempt to fly around the world without a drop of fuel. The aircraft landed in two Indian cities, Ahmadabad and Varanasi. It is scheduled to return to Abu Dhabi in August.
